Musty Odors That Won't Go Away
If you notice a musty smell that persists even after cleaning, it's a sign of water damage. This can lead to mold growth, which is a serious health risk. Don't ignore the smell. Take action now. Call a professional.
Water Stains on the Ceiling or Walls
Water stains on your ceiling or walls are a clear indication of water damage. Don't ignore these signs, as they can lead to further damage and costly repairs. Don't wait until it's too late. Take action now. Call a professional.
Drywall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ill (less than 10 square feet) | Yes | No | DIY kits are available for small spills, and you can handle it yourself with some basic tools. |
| Large water spill (more than 100 square feet) | No | Yes | This needs specialized equipment and expertise to handle safely and effectively. |
| Water damage behind walls or ceilings | No | Yes | This need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and repair safely and effectively. |
| Water damage with mold growth | No | Yes | Mold growth needs specialized equipment and expertise to handle safely and effectively. |
| Water damage in a finished basement or crawl space | No | Yes | This needs specialized equipment and expertise to handle safely and effectively, especially in finished spaces. |
| Water damage with electrical or structural issues | No | Yes | This needs specialized equipment and expertise to handle safely and effectively, especially with electrical or structural issues. |

Drywall Water Damage Repair Cost in Wilmington, OH
The cost of drywall water damage repair varies based on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Wilmington, OH.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the damage. No hidden costs. Only transparent pricing. Get a clear understanding.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 - $2,500 |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and local conditions. |
| Drywall repair or replacement | $1,000 - $5,000 |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and local conditions. |
| Finishing touches (primer and paint) | $500 - $2,000 |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and local conditions. |
| More services (mold remediation, electrical or structural repair) | $1,000 - $5,000 | Sever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. |
| Emergency services (24/7 response) | $500 - $2,000 | Sever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. |
| Free estimate and consultation | Free |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the damage. |
